Understanding Application Performance Management (APM) and API Terminology

APM and API Performance Monitoring: Optimized Guide for Enterprises  

In today’s interconnected digital ecosystems, APIs are the lifeline of innovation. They power microservices, facilitate data sharing, and enable real-time integrations. But with great power comes great responsibility—ensuring these APIs and their underlying services remain high-performing, available, and observable is no longer optional. This is where APM and API monitoring come into play.

As applications grow more complex and distributed, developers and operations teams increasingly face challenges in identifying bottlenecks, tracking down performance issues, and maintaining overall system health. As a result, performance observability is no longer just a backend concern; instead, it has become a critical business imperative.

The Critical Business Need for APM and API Integration

Understanding the Modern Application Ecosystem

Today’s applications are fundamentally different from their monolithic predecessors. Modern enterprise applications typically consist of:

  • 50-200+ microservices communicating through APIs

  • Multiple cloud providers hosting different application components

  • Third-party integrations ranging from payment processors to analytics platforms

  • Edge computing nodes delivering content closer to users

  • Mobile and web clients with varying performance characteristics

This distributed architecture creates unprecedented monitoring challenges. A single user transaction might traverse dozens of services, cross multiple network boundaries, and involve numerous API calls. Without proper APM and API monitoring, identifying performance bottlenecks becomes nearly impossible.

 

The Financial Impact of Performance Issues
APM and API: Understanding Performance Monitoring

Recent industry research reveals the staggering cost of poor application performance:

Direct Revenue Impact:

  • Amazon loses $1.6 billion annually for every second of latency

  • Google experiences a 20% drop in traffic for every additional 0.5 seconds of page load time

  • Walmart saw a 2% increase in conversions for every 1-second improvement in page load time

Customer Experience Degradation:

  • 79% of users who experience poor website performance are less likely to buy from the same site again

  • 44% of users share negative experiences with friends and colleagues

  • 88% of online consumers are less likely to return to a site after a bad experience

Operational Costs:

  • Average cost of application downtime: $5,600 per minute

  • Mean time to resolution without proper APM: 4-6 hours

  • Developer productivity loss due to poor monitoring: 35-40%

These statistics underscore why APM and API integration isn’t just a technical consideration—it’s a strategic business imperative that directly impacts revenue, customer satisfaction, and operational efficiency.

The Role of APM in Modern Infrastructure

APM and API: Understanding Performance Monitoring

Application Performance Monitoring (APM) tools, in particular, give developers and operations teams deep visibility into how applications behave in production environments. Meanwhile, while API monitoring focuses specifically on endpoints, APM, on the other hand, looks at the underlying infrastructure, code execution, and dependencies.

Together, APM and API monitoring create a complete performance picture—from user request to backend processing. This comprehensive approach is crucial when diagnosing complex bugs or scaling bottlenecks that may not be visible through logs alone.

APM helps organizations answer key questions like:

  • Which services are slowing down transactions?

  • Are there memory leaks or CPU spikes?

  • How do performance changes correlate with deployments?

  • What’s the root cause of degraded app performance?

With robust APM and API solutions in place, teams can proactively identify issues, set intelligent alerts, and maintain service-level objectives (SLOs).

Essential API Performance Metrics

Not all metrics carry equal weight. Here are the most important API performance metrics every team should monitor:

Core Performance Indicators:

  • Latency – How long it takes for the API to respond

  • Error Rate – Percentage of requests that fail

  • Request Volume – Number of incoming API calls

  • Throughput – How much data is processed per second

  • Dependency Failures – Downstream issues affecting the API

These metrics help developers benchmark performance, plan capacity, and detect anomalies before users experience issues.

 

Container and Kubernetes Monitoring Excellence
APM and API: Understanding Performance Monitoring

Pod-Level Performance Analysis

Container-based deployments introduce unique monitoring challenges that APM and API solutions must address:

Resource Utilization Tracking:

  • CPU throttling detection identifies containers hitting resource limits

  • Memory pressure analysis preventing out-of-memory kill events

  • Network bandwidth monitoring ensures adequate connectivity for API communication

  • Storage I/O performance tracking persistent volume performance impact

Container Lifecycle Monitoring:

  • Startup time analysis optimizing application initialization

  • Graceful shutdown tracking ensures proper connection cleanup

  • Health check effectiveness verifying readiness and liveness probe accuracy

  • Auto-scaling trigger analysis understanding when and why pods scale

Kubernetes-Native APM Integration

Service Discovery and Endpoint Management:

Kubernetes’s dynamic nature requires APM and API systems to adapt continuously:

  • Label-based service identification using Kubernetes metadata

  • Annotation-driven configuration enabling per-service monitoring customization

  • Namespace isolation provides multi-tenant monitoring capabilities

  • Ingress controller integration monitoring external traffic entry points

Cluster-Wide Performance Optimization:

  • Resource contention detection identifies noisy neighbor problems

  • Kernel-level monitoring using eBPF for deep system visibility

  • API server response time tracking ensuring cluster responsiveness

  • etcd performance analysis monitoring cluster state storage efficiency

Real-Time Performance Optimization Strategies

Dynamic Resource Allocation

Modern APM and API systems enable intelligent, automated resource management through:

Predictive Scaling Algorithms:

  • Time series analysis predicting traffic patterns based on historical data

  • Event-driven scaling responding to scheduled events and promotions

  • Business KPI-based scaling using conversion rates and revenue per request

  • Resource utilization efficiency optimizing cost per transaction

Intelligent Caching Strategies:

  • Hit ratio analysis identifying opportunities for cache expansion

  • TTL optimization balancing data freshness with performance

  • Multi-layer caching architecture from application to CDN levels

  • Cache warming strategies proactively loading frequently accessed data

API Rate Limiting and Throttling

Adaptive Rate Limiting:

Traditional fixed rate limiting fails in dynamic environments. Modern APM and API solutions implement intelligent throttling:

  • Performance-based throttling maintaining quality of service through response time thresholds

  • User-tier based limiting ensuring premium customers receive priority

  • Geographic rate distribution optimizing global service delivery

  • Error rate circuit breakers protecting upstream services

Circuit Breaker Implementation:

  • Statistical failure analysis using configurable error thresholds

  • Gradual traffic restoration safely returning to normal operation

  • Fallback mechanism activation providing degraded but functional service

  • Health check integration incorporating external service status

Modern Monitoring Strategies That Scale

As businesses increasingly adopt cloud-native architectures, however, legacy monitoring strategies often fall short. Therefore, a modern APM and API monitoring strategy should include the following components:

Distributed Tracing: Useful for microservices architectures, distributed tracing shows how a request moves through the system, therefore helping isolate slow or failing services across multiple API calls.

Real-Time Dashboards: Visibility into key KPIs (latency, errors, throughput) in real time allows teams to act fast when anomalies occur, providing immediate insight into APM and API performance.

Intelligent Alerting and Anomaly Detection: Threshold-based and AI-based alerting systems reduce MTTR (Mean Time to Resolution) by immediately notifying relevant teams of performance degradation.

Enterprise APM and API Tool Selection Framework

Technical Capability Assessment

Data Collection and Processing:

  • Ingestion capacity: Minimum 1M events/second with linear scalability

  • Real-time processing: Sub-second alerting for critical performance thresholds

  • Multi-cloud support: Native integration across AWS, Azure, GCP, and hybrid environments

Monitoring Coverage:

  • Language support: Comprehensive coverage for Java, .NET, Python, Node.js, Go, Ruby

  • Database monitoring: MySQL, PostgreSQL, MongoDB, Redis, Elasticsearch

  • Message queue integration: Kafka, RabbitMQ, Amazon SQS, Azure Service Bus

Advanced Analytics:

  • Machine learning capabilities: Automated anomaly detection and root cause analysis

  • Custom dashboard creation: Advanced visualization options for APM and API metrics

  • Predictive analytics: Capacity planning and performance forecasting

Enterprise Integration Requirements

Security and Compliance:

  • Data encryption: End-to-end encryption for data in transit and at rest

  • Access control: Role-based permissions with SSO integration

  • Compliance certifications: SOC 2, HIPAA, PCI DSS, GDPR compliance

Scalability and Performance:

  • Agent overhead: Less than 5% CPU and memory impact

  • High availability: 99.9%+ uptime SLA with geographic redundancy

  • Multi-tenancy: Secure isolation for different business units

Integrating APM and API Monitoring into DevOps

In fact, a mature DevOps practice consistently treats observability as a first-class concern. Moreover, integrating APM and API monitoring into CI/CD pipelines ensures that performance regressions are identified and addressed early on.

Performance Budget Implementation: Performance budgets can, therefore, be set at the API level. For example, in such cases, a deployment should fail if the average response time increases by more than 20%. As a result, this builds confidence in the release process and, furthermore, encourages developers to prioritize performance alongside functionality.

Unified Observability: Centralizing logs, traces, and metrics into a unified dashboard saves teams from context-switching and speeds up root-cause analysis, making APM and API data more actionable.

Real-World Implementation Example

Consider a large ecommerce application that, for example, uses a microservices architecture. Specifically, one microservice handles product listings, another manages checkout, and a third is responsible for payments. These microservices, in turn, are exposed through APIs that are consumed by both frontend apps and third-party vendors.

Without proper APM and API monitoring, a latency issue in the payment API might go unnoticed until users abandon their carts. But with integrated monitoring:

  1. Detection: The payment service shows a 30% increase in latency post-deployment

  2. Analysis: Distributed tracing reveals the issue is due to a downstream dependency change

  3. Resolution: Teams roll back the change, and performance returns to normal within minutes

This rapid resolution is only possible when APM and API observability is proactive, not reactive.

The Evolution Toward Contextual Intelligence

Modern APM and API tools go beyond simply tracking metrics; in fact, they provide much-needed context. Rather than just showing a spike in CPU usage, advanced platforms now go a step further by correlating that spike with factors such as:

  • Recent deployments

  • API error surges

  • User complaint spikes

  • Infrastructure changes

This contextual intelligence reduces noise and helps teams focus on what matters, featuring:

  • Smart instrumentation for code-level diagnostics

  • Heatmaps for identifying performance hotspots

  • Correlated logs and traces in a single view

  • AI-powered insights for anomaly detection

Future Directions for APM and API Observability

As architectures continue to shift toward serverless, event-driven systems, and edge computing, the nature of observability must therefore evolve. In this evolving landscape, APIs will still continue to play a central role in enabling data flow, coordinating orchestration, and facilitating external connectivity.

Emerging Capabilities:

  • Lightweight yet powerful monitoring for serverless environments

  • Integration-friendly across diverse tech stacks

  • Real-time, actionable insights with minimal overhead

  • SLA tracking for external partners and geo-based latency analysis

Moreover, the blend of APM and API visibility will continue to grow tighter. As a result, unified observability platforms are becoming the standard—ultimately helping developers, SREs, and business teams speak the same language of performance.

Key Implementation Takeaways

Strategic Priorities:

  • APIs are business-critical; their performance directly impacts users and revenue

  • APM and API monitoring offer a complete view from frontend to backend

  • Use distributed tracing, real-time dashboards, and intelligent alerting for modern observability

  • Design your APIs with monitoring in mind—clean architecture makes observability easier

Practical Steps:

  • Invest in tools that scale with your infrastructure and align with your DevOps workflow

  • Implement performance budgets in your CI/CD pipeline

  • Focus on contextual intelligence, not just raw metrics

  • Plan for the future with cloud-native, microservices-ready solutions

 

The Role of Microservice API Design in Performance Monitoring

Modern systems, therefore, demand robust microservice api design for scalable performance. In particular, clean interface definitions, proper version control, effective rate limiting, and standardized responses are all critical for ensuring predictable behavior and enhanced observability.

Moreover, enterprises investing in microservice api design experience improved traceability, faster debugging, and greater autonomy across teams. In fact, monitoring can only be truly effective when the APIs themselves are designed with both clarity and consistency.

 

Key Takeaways

  1. APIs are business-critical; their performance directly impacts users and revenue.

  2. APM and API monitoring offer a complete view from the frontend to the backend

  3. Use distributed tracing, real-time dashboards, and smart alerting for modern observability.

  4. Design your APIs with monitoring in mind—clean architecture makes observability easier.

  5. Invest in tools that scale with your infrastructure and align with your DevOps workflow.

Conclusion

As software systems continue to grow in complexity, APM and API performance monitoring must therefore evolve from reactive troubleshooting to proactive optimization. In today’s environment, it’s no longer just about avoiding downtime—instead, it’s about consistently delivering exceptional user experiences, enabling faster time-to-resolution, and supporting more informed engineering decisions.

By proactively integrating APM and API monitoring into your development lifecycle, you not only empower your team to move faster but also enable them to respond smarter. As a result, they can build software that performs flawlessly under pressure. Furthermore, the organizations that choose to invest in comprehensive observability today will ultimately be the ones that thrive in tomorrow’s increasingly complex digital landscape.
Do you like to read more educational content? Read our blogs at Cloudastra Technologies or contact us for business enquiry at Cloudastra Contact Us

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top